How do I grade or condition-check a Nemo Pop! Disney?
Examine the vinyl body for hairline cracks, particularly around the head and fins, and inspect the painted details for chips or scuffs. Check that the eyes are firmly attached and free from cloudiness or separation. Verify that the original box is present, as it significantly impacts value, and look for wear on the corners or spine. Note that this 2013 release is a first-generation figure, so any factory defects like paint smears should be documented.
